What makes the most complex feature of a kitchenaid 7 speed hand mixer, and how do you use it?
The most complex feature is how the attachments interact with the speed range to handle different tasks. Use whisk attachments for whipped toppings or airy batters, beaters for creaming and mixing, and dough hooks for kneading bread or pizza dough, adjusting speed to control splatter. Ensure the mixer you choose includes stainless steel beaters and dough hooks for versatility. Start low to create a stable base, then increase speed gradually as ingredients come together.
Should a beginner or a pro use a kitchenaid 7 speed hand mixer, and in what scenarios?
A beginner should start with gentle tasks like whisking eggs and mixing batters at low speeds to learn control. A pro benefits from higher speeds when whipping cream, beating stiff mixtures, or kneading small batches of dough efficiently. This hand mixer’s seven speeds accommodate both ends of the spectrum, provided you pair the right attachments with each task. Match your typical recipes and pace to the appropriate speed range.
What maintenance and compatibility tips should I follow for a kitchenaid 7 speed hand mixer?
Detach and hand-wash or rinse attachments after use to keep them sanitary and prevent corrosion. Check that you’re using the correct beaters, whisk, or dough hooks designed for seven-speed hand mixers, and avoid forcing attachments that don’t fit. Inspect the power cord and switch for wear, and store the unit in a dry place to prevent moisture damage.
